Transaction 51522660cf006f05d82c21a6f9c53a9c8afae805ea7fbcf3109704914018427b

1 Input
2 Outputs
  • 51522660cf006f05d82c21a6f9c53a9c8afae805ea7fbcf3109704914018427b:0
  • value  40000000
    address  3MzwsqGG3iGD57ZjWJ7sLUWDHtDiDAgo4K
  • 51522660cf006f05d82c21a6f9c53a9c8afae805ea7fbcf3109704914018427b:1
  • value  178030071
    address  1EJazm1rbDT4TL8sog23widcaiheSnBbTx